Burger King employee who ran store alone for 12 hours shared heartbreaking video before being fired

The 25-year-old mum shared a tearful video after being sacked from the fast food chain

Joshua Nair

Joshua Nair

The Burger King employee who made headlines for running a store on her own for an entire shift has shared an emotional video after being sacked.

Nykia Hamilton, a mum-of-three, was the subject of a viral video which has been doing the rounds this summer.

A customer got their phone out to film the fast food worker holding down the fort at a Burger King branch in Columbia, South Carolina, all by herself.

"She’s doing everything she needs to do to make sure everybody is okay in here," the customer said in the TikTok video.

The 'Burger King mom', as she's been dubbed, told news channels that she works hard for her children, as she claimed that 'nobody wants to work no more'.

But following her heroics, the 25-year-old was sacked for being late, just days after going viral.

Nykia was heartbroken, previously claiming: "I’m already aggravated, I’m already depressed, all of this mental s***, and motherf****** f*****g with me, so leave me alone."

But on her own page, the mum posted a tearful video about her viral fame prior to her sacking, sharing how strongly she feels about her children with social media followers.

Advert

Thanking fans for their support, Nykia went on: "Everyday, the story's getting bigger and bigger. Like I said, I wasn't expecting to get recognised."

She explained that she's been working since 14, while being a single mother since she was just 17.

"Now that I'm 25, it's something that I'm used to, I gotta work, I gotta do. I don't want recognition, I don't want flowers, I don't want nobody to feel bad for me, I don't want sympathy," she insisted.



Advert


Nykia shared that she's got a criminal record but is looking to turn her life around, but 'everybody is not perfect'.

"I went to the video that went viral of me, I went to the comments, my son commented," she said before trying to fight back tears.

"He said, 'I know my mama love me', and I do," Nykia said while crying.

Advert

The mum went on: "I don't care if I break every bone in my body, I'm gonna make sure my kids got it so they would never have to go out in this world and ask nobody for nothing."

She highlighted that she wants her children to be 'independent young women and men', and said she would 'always be there' for them.

"Yes, I'm crying like a punk a** b***h, but like I said, for my kids, I'll always be a punk a** b***h," she concluded.

Nykia had previously thanked her general manager for the gig, having been given a chance despite her criminal record.

Advert

However, she would go on to claim days after this video: "[Burger King] fired me because I’ve been late because of my kids,

"My kids come first. Y’all don’t pay for no babysitter, or nothing."

The mother has since launched a GoFundMe, which has so far raised over $72,000 of its $90,000 target.

LADbible has previously reached out to Burger King for comment.
